Étude de cas PancakeSwap x Dysnix

L'infrastructure DEX gère 100 000 RPS avec une réponse 62,5 fois plus rapide.

Rencontrez PancakeSwap

PancakeSwap est un échange décentralisé populaire (DEX) construit sur la Binance Smart Chain. Il utilise des contrats intelligents automatisés pour faciliter l'échange de cryptomonnaies directement entre les utilisateurs. PancakeSwap propose également des fonctionnalités telles que le jalonnement et le yield farming, permettant aux utilisateurs de gagner des récompenses sur leurs avoirs.

Lors d'événements tels que les parachutages, il est soumis à des charges de trafic massives de plus de 100 000 RPS, et notre équipe a créé une infrastructure capable de le gérer facilement.

Problèmes que nous avons résolus

Tâches
terminé 200 000$ coûts mensuels estimés pour la maintenance de l'infrastructure blockchain
Intertemps d'arrêt réguliers des terminaux publics
Des pics de latence incontrôlables ont été provoqués ~3270 millisecondes retards pour les utilisateurs de DEX
Les utilisateurs ont eu des erreurs en essayant d'envoyer des transactions à l'aide de points de terminaison BSC publics
Résultats
Réduction des coûts d'infrastructure en 70 %
Le temps de réponse maximal a été réduit de 62,5 temps
Infrastructure stabilisée avec 158 112 000 000 demandes par mois
Atteint ~ 99,9 % uptime
Latence réduite à ~80 ms

Solutions mises en œuvre par Dysnix

Cluster de nœuds Blockchain
Fast and secure self-hosted cluster of geo-distributed blockchain nodes
Autoscaler des nœuds d'IA prédictifs
Échelle proactive pour un équilibre parfait des ressources sans retards
Proxy de mise en cache JSON RPC
Les connexions les plus rapides et les plus sécurisées pour tout projet de blockchain
Rotation automatique des nœuds
Maintien de la bonne santé de tous les nœuds dans l'environnement de production

Cette affaire sous les projecteurs du GCP

«Avec Google Kubernetes Engine, la solution PreditKube de Dysnix a prédit avec précision plus de 90 % des pics de trafic sur PancakeSwap et une échelle ascendante et descendante automatisée des nœuds blockchain à l'avance pour gérer correctement l'augmentation de trafic prévue. Cela a donné lieu à plus de 30 % de réduction des coûts et a réduit le temps de réponse maximal de 62,5 fois.
PancakeSwap : Soutenir l'écosystème DeFi grâce à une infrastructure toujours disponible
En savoir plus
Daniel Yavorovych
Co-fondateur et directeur technique
Vous recherchez la même solution complète ? Nous le personnaliserons pour vous.